Description
Enjoy crispy, crunchy fish sticks made with tender white fish fillets. Perfect for a weeknight dinner or as a fun party appetizer.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ound white fish fillets (e.g., cod or haddock)
- 1 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Cooking oil for frying
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Cut the fish fillets into finger-sized sticks.
- In one bowl, mix the flour,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and paprika. In another bowl, beat the eggs. In a third bowl, place the breadcrumbs.
- Dredge each fish stick in the flour mixture, dip in the beaten eggs, and coat with breadcrumbs.
- Heat cooking oil in a frying pan over medium heat. Fry the fish sticks for 3-4 minutes on each side until golden brown. Transfer to a baking sheet and bake for an additional 10 minutes.
- Serve with your favorite dipping sauce.
Notes
Make sure your oil is hot before frying for a crispy texture. Use panko breadcrumbs for extra crunch.
